If the class is approved for NYS CE: LIBOR strictly follows Section 176.6 of the NYS License Law – Article 12A. Students are only permitted to miss 10% of classroom time. If more than 10% of class time is missed for any reason, NYS continuing education credits will not be issued. All New York licensing classes follow the same law for permissible time missed.

What is Cultural Competency? "Cultural competency means being aware of your own cultural beliefs and values and how these may be different from other cultures—including being able to learn about and honor the different cultures of those you live and work with." The three elements of cultural competence are: • attitudes. • skills. • knowledge. 4 Steps to Becoming Culturally Competent • Learn About Your Culture and Biases. Many of the biases we hold are unconscious, meaning we're not aware we have them. • Actively Listen. Active listening is a useful tool for practicing cultural competency. • Show Interest Through Participation. • Seek Out Cultural Knowledge. For the past 30 years, Real Estate professionals and their homebuyers have found new opportunities with the strength of FHA 203(k) and HomeStyles Renovation financing. Reinventing the deal can help you level the playing field for your home buyers and create exciting HomeOwnership opportunities with more inventory of homes right in our own backyards. This course is a follow up to the popular “Success with 203(k) Financing” enjoyed by 100s of agents and will hopefully give you too, that “yeah, you can do that” knowledge to Reinvent the deal by: • Expanding your clients searches to more affordable “fixer-uppers” and TLC properties. • Opening up REO inventory that was once only available to “cash only” buyers • Learn how to attract more buyers to your listings with a “yeah you can do that” vision • Learn how to close on homes with some title issues or violations…”yeah, you can do that” • Work with not only owner-occupied sales, but also second homes and Investors This course will teach you exactly how these powerful programs work.
